you are really asking a question about tradition v common sense.
On a personal note i prefer the silence.
You always have the silence option when it is a gathering of people who have made a journey of their own free will to pay tribute to somebody.
When you go to a football match,as an example,and attempt to honour somebody or something that everybody might not wish to show respect for, you are in effect giving, every dick head and every drunk the opportunity to have his moment of fame.
Also you will often get noises from the concourses from people who don't realise there is a minutes silence going on.
That gets the inevitable piss pots screaming abuse which tends to pick up a head of steam.
A minutes applause is i believe better placed at such times and let's be honest and say it's not offensive.it is just not traditional.
So what, i would rather have a minutes applause than the moment being totally ruined |
